  • Publication number: 20030165222
    Abstract: The invention relates to a method and a system implementing the method for arranging subscriber billing in a multi-provider environment wherein a subscriber desiring a service uses both a first network (A) and a second network (T). In order to bill the subscriber, either a tariff of the second network (T) is transmitted to the first network (A), a tariff of the first network is combined with the tariff of the second network and the subscriber is billed according to the combined tariff, or a billing identifier is generated in the first network (A) to be transmitted to the second network (T), the billing identifier is attached to billing information in both networks and the pieces of the billing information that comprise the same billing identifier are combined in order to bill the subscriber. The invention thus enables a subscriber in a multi-provider environment to be billed using a single bill.

  • Publication number: 20020127995
    Abstract: In a first embodiment of the invention, when an Activate PDP Context Request message is forwarded to a Service GPRS Support Node (SGSN), the SGSN creates a Create PDP Context Request message and forwards it to a Gateway GPRS Support Node (GGSN). In response to the Create PDP Context Request forwarded by the SGSN, the GGSN creates a Create PDP Context Response message. When a PDP context is created by the GGSN, the GGSN associates a Globally Unique Charging Identification (GCI) with the PDP context. Then, the Create PDP Context Response including the GCI is forwarded to the SGSN. The GCI is sent from the SGSN to the UE and from the UE to the CSCF. In a second embodiment of the invention, the GCI is sent from the SGSN or the GGSN directly to the Call State Control Function (CSCF). Sending the GCI can be performed either autonomously or based on a request from the CSCF.
